About the Business

Mount Eden Park is a picturesque park located in Hayward, California, United States. Situated at 2451 West Tennyson Road, this tourist attraction offers stunning views of the surrounding landscape and is the perfect spot for a leisurely stroll or a family picnic. With its lush greenery, walking trails, and peaceful atmosphere, Mount Eden Park is a popular destination for both locals and visitors looking to escape the hustle and bustle of city life. Whether you're looking to relax in nature or simply enjoy the outdoors, this park is a must-visit destination in Hayward.

"a review from @amom2kidsandapark This park has everything you need and more! With a playground, picnic areas, a rose garden, soccer field, basket ball court, horse shop pits and more, it really feels like the possibility are endless. Along with the soccer and basketball fields/courts there are other recreation options including tennis, shuffle board, baseball and softball. The playground is fairly large. There are two slides (short straight and tube spiral), steps, ladders, the tunnel/ramp bridge seen at other Hayward parks, balance beam, climbing wall, and monkey bars. The play area also has a swing set with standard and bucket swings. The smaller slide is only accessible via ladder. This park has so much grass and if you’re lucky on a hot day you’ll be there when the sprinklers are on. Don’t miss the rose garden and statue in front of the historic house. There are two small parking lots off of Tennyson but street parking on Darwin gets you closed to the playground. There are bathrooms near the ball fields."
